The Chan-Evans-Lam N-Arylation of 2-Imidazolines
Dmitry Dar'in1, Mikhail Krasavin1
1Institute of Chemistry, Saint Petersburg State University , 26 Universitetsky prospekt, Peterhof 198504, Russia.
Abstract:
N-Arylation of 2-imidazolines with arylboronic acids promoted by copper(II) acetate in DMSO provides an attractive alternative to the earlier reported transition metal-catalyzed approaches employing (hetero)aryl halides as it taps into the vast reagent space of commercially available boronic acids and proceeds at ambient temperature. Many of the resulting compounds are distinctly lead-like, thus positioning the method developed well within the toolbox of lead-oriented synthesis.
